Best honeymoon destinations in May in India

In May, India offers several stunning honeymoon destinations where you can experience diverse landscapes, cultures, and experiences. Here are some of the best honeymoon destinations in India for the month of May:

  • Leh-Ladakh, Jammu and Kashmir: May marks the beginning of the tourist season in Leh-Ladakh. The weather is pleasant, and the landscapes are breathtaking. Couples can indulge in adventure activities like trekking, river rafting, and camping amidst the serene Himalayan beauty.
  • Srinagar, Jammu and Kashmir: Srinagar, the summer capital of Jammu and Kashmir, is known for its picturesque Dal Lake, houseboats, and Mughal gardens. May is an ideal time to explore the beauty of Srinagar before the peak tourist season starts.
  • Manali, Himachal Pradesh: Manali is a popular honeymoon destination known for its scenic beauty, snow-capped mountains, and adventure activities. May offers pleasant weather, making it perfect for exploring attractions like Rohtang Pass, Solang Valley, and Hadimba Temple.
  • Shimla, Himachal Pradesh: Shimla, the capital city of Himachal Pradesh, is a charming hill station known for its colonial architecture, lush greenery, and pleasant climate. May is an excellent time to enjoy leisurely walks, visit historic sites, and explore nearby attractions like Kufri and Chail.
  • Darjeeling, West Bengal: Darjeeling, nestled in the foothills of the Himalayas, is renowned for its tea gardens, scenic beauty, and panoramic views of Mt. Kanchenjunga. May offers clear skies and pleasant weather, allowing couples to enjoy activities like toy train rides, trekking, and exploring Buddhist monasteries.
  • Goa: While May is the beginning of the off-season in Goa due to the onset of the monsoon, it can still be a romantic time to visit if you prefer quieter beaches and lush green landscapes. You can enjoy water sports, beach hopping, and exploring the vibrant culture and cuisine of Goa.
  • Andaman and Nicobar Islands: May is a good time to visit the Andaman and Nicobar Islands before the onset of the monsoon. Couples can enjoy pristine beaches, water sports, snorkeling, scuba diving, and exploring the rich marine life and coral reefs.

These destinations offer a mix of natural beauty, adventure, and cultural experiences, making them perfect for a memorable honeymoon in May in India. Remember to check travel advisories and weather forecasts before planning your trip.
